The entry-price trap

Instantly is billed in modules

The headline price covers sending only. Instantly sells three building blocks separately, and the bill climbs fast as you stack them. Here is what each module costs.

Sending suite (cold email)

The heart of the product: campaigns, warmup, Unibox, sequences. From $37.60 (Growth) to $286.30/mo (Light Speed) on annual billing. This is the module broken down in the table above.

Lead database (Credits)

The database of 450M+ B2B contacts, with search and verification, runs on credits under a separate subscription. ~$42.30/mo (Growth), ~$87.30/mo (Supersonic), from ~$177/mo (Hyper). Budget about 1.5 credit (~$0.03) per verified pro email found.

Instantly CRM

The native CRM (deal tracking, tasks, follow-ups) is still a separate module: ~$37.90/mo (Growth) or ~$77.60/mo (Hyper, with AI, calls and SMS).

Done-For-You (turnkey)

The managed offer (domain and inbox setup, campaigns, AI Sales Agent) exists mostly at the high end, quote-based, at several thousand dollars a year. Watch out: provisioned domains stay managed by Instantly and are not recoverable if you leave.

  • Already have your lists? The sending suite alone may be enough.
  • Starting from scratch? Add the lead database (Credits) to your math.
  • Want to track deals inside Instantly? The CRM is extra.
  • Managing several clients? Plan for an agency workspace, billed separately.
  • Warmup is included everywhere: no extra charge on that front.
Our method

How we price the real cost

The price Instantly advertises does not tell you what you actually pay, because the tool is modular. For the full stack, we add the three modules on their Growth entry tier, on annual billing. Here is the breakdown.

  1. Sending suite (Growth)Campaigns, unlimited warmup, Unibox
    $37.60
  2. Lead database (Growth)450M+ contacts, billed on credits
    $42.30
  3. CRM (Growth)Deal tracking, tasks and follow-ups
    $37.90
  4. Total per monthAbout 3x the advertised entry price
    ~$118

Pricing FAQ

Frequently asked questions about Instantly's price

  • How much does Instantly cost per month?
    Instantly starts at $37.60/mo on the Growth plan with annual billing, or $47/mo billed monthly. But that rate only covers the sending suite. If you add the lead database (~$42.30/mo) and the CRM (~$37.90/mo), a full stack lands closer to about $118/mo. The higher plans climb to $77.60/mo (Hypergrowth) and $286.30/mo (Light Speed) on annual billing. The smart move is to start with the sending suite alone and add the modules only if you need them.
  • How much does Instantly cost per year?
    On annual billing, the Growth plan works out to about $451/yr ($37.60 x 12), Hypergrowth to about $931/yr, and Light Speed to about $3,436/yr, for the sending suite alone. Going annual saves roughly 20% versus monthly on sending. If you add the lead database and the CRM, budget around $1,400/yr for a full Growth stack. Always check the exact price on the official page before paying, as the tiers can change.
  • Does Instantly have a free plan?
    No, Instantly has no permanent free plan. It does offer a 14-day free trial, no credit card required, that covers the sending suite, the lead database and the CRM. You get the features of your chosen plan during the trial: warmup, Unibox, sequencer, analytics. That is enough to test deliverability on a few inboxes before you commit. After the 14 days, you have to switch to a paid plan to keep sending.
  • Is warmup included in Instantly's price?
    Yes. Warmup, the gradual ramp-up of your inboxes that protects your deliverability, is unlimited and included on every sending plan, at no extra charge. That is a real edge over tools that bill warmup on top or cap it. So you can connect as many sending accounts as you want and warm them all, within your plan's email quota and active contact limit (1,000 on Growth). Warmup runs on Instantly's private deliverability network.
  • How much does a full setup on Instantly cost?
    Budget about $118/mo on annual billing for a full stack: Growth sending suite ($37.60) + Growth lead database (~$42.30) + Growth CRM (~$37.90). That is about three times the advertised entry price, because Instantly bills its modules separately. For a small growing team, the total climbs to around $210/mo, and for a high-volume agency to around $551/mo. If you already have your lists and your CRM, you can stay on the sending suite alone at ~$38/mo.
  • Is Instantly more expensive than Smartlead or Lemlist?
    It depends on the model. Smartlead is the cheapest for sending alone, from $39/mo. Instantly at $37.60/mo on annual is comparable on sending, but bills the lead database and the CRM separately. Lemlist is pricier because it is billed per seat (around $59/seat/mo), so its price climbs with team size, while Instantly stays at the same platform rate. Apollo, at $49/user/mo, includes its database from the entry tier, which can make it cheaper if you need data.
  • Is the lead database included in Instantly's price?
    No. The database of 450M+ B2B contacts, formerly SuperSearch, is a separate module, billed on credits, under its own subscription. It starts around $42.30/mo (Growth) on annual, then ~$87.30/mo (Supersonic) and from ~$177/mo (Hyper) for larger volumes. Budget about 1.5 credit, or ~$0.03, to find a verified professional email, and 0.25 credit to verify an email you already own. If you already have your lists, you can skip this module and use only the sending suite.
  • Is there a discount for paying Instantly yearly?
    Yes. Annual billing saves roughly 20% on the sending suite (the Growth plan drops from $47 to $37.60/mo) and on the CRM, and about 10% on the leads module. That is the main way to pay less for Instantly. There is no reliable recurring official promo code, so be wary of third-party coupon pages. The best lever is the annual commitment, plus subscribing only to the modules you actually need.
  • How much does Instantly cost for an agency?
    For a high-volume agency, budget around $551/mo on annual billing: Light Speed sending suite ($286.30) + Hyper lead database (~$170) + Hyper CRM (~$95), before any add-ons like website visitors or extra capacity. Good news: Instantly is priced by volume, not per seat, so you do not pay more for adding users. Bad news: managing several clients can require an agency workspace, billed on top. Request a quote for the Enterprise plan if you go beyond these volumes.
  • Can you cancel Instantly easily?
    Yes, the subscription cancels from your account, with no long lock-in on monthly plans. The thing to watch is the Done-For-You service: the domains and inboxes provisioned by Instantly stay managed by the platform and are not recoverable if you leave, a recurring complaint in reviews. If you want to keep control of your domains, provision them yourself rather than through the managed service. Also remember to export your data and your leads before closing your account.
